Crystagen
Also known as: EDP, Glu-Asp-Pro
Crystagen is a synthetic tripeptide (Glu-Asp-Pro, EDP) short-peptide bioregulator developed by Vladimir Khavinson and colleagues at the St. Petersburg Institute of Bioregulation and Gerontology as an immune-system bioregulator. The Khavinson group reports it modulates immune-cell gene expression and chromatin organization, influencing T-cell, B-cell, and thymic epithelial activity via direct peptide-DNA interaction. Evidence is confined to single-group preclinical and small clinical studies; it is not FDA-approved and lacks independent Western validation. 3 citations indexed for Crystagen
review · 2022
Transport of Biologically Active Ultrashort Peptides Using POT and LAT Carriers
Ultrashort peptides (USPs), consisting of 2-7 amino-acid residues, are a group of signaling molecules that regulate gene expression and protein synthesis under normal conditions in various diseases and ageing. USPs serve as a basis for the development of drugs with a targeted mechanism of action.

Study · 2014
[Molecular aspects of immunoprotective activity of peptides in spleen during the ageing process]
Vilon, Timogen, Crystagen and R-1 short peptides possess various immunoprotective effects in spleen during its ageing. Both R-1 and Vilon peptides activate T-helpers.
